Maverick County Livestock Control

The following horses and donkeys have been picked up by the Maverick County Sheriff's Office.




These two horses were picked up off of Day Road in Quemado, Texas on August 28th, 2017 after they were found on the roadway, causing a hazard to passing traffic. The grey horse is a Gelding and is about sixteen hands tall. The second horse found is a Bay mare with a ~C brand on it.

















These donkeys were picked up off of FM1666 in Quemado, Texas on August 31st after they had reportedly caused damages to a property.

Horses and livestock found loose or tied up without proper food or water will be picked up at the owner's expense. A pick up fee of $25.00 will be assessed and stable fees are $18.00 per day. After an eighteen day period without being claimed, the animals are subject to auction.
